递阶分布式控制系统设计软件的开发

来源 :昆明理工大学 | 被引量 : 0次 | 上传用户:pc167
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
递阶分布式控制系统是实现复杂大系统的理想方案,本文以液体液位和温度控制器为例提出了递阶分布式控制系统的设计思想,本文提出的递阶分布式控制系统的设计是基于任务分解的思想来实现的,通过把一个复杂的控制任务分解成一系列简单的且易实现的子任务,并且这些子任务由一系列模块来完成,这样设计出的控制系统具有模块化的结构,从而使得系统具有良好的可扩展性和可维护性。 在递阶分布式控制系统中,控制任务是由各模块间的相互协调动作来完成的,各模块可以在不同的计算机或不同的操作平台上运行,模块间的通信是通过通信管理系统CMS和中间消息语言NML来实现,其中CMS是底层通信系统,而NML是用户与CMS的接口,CMS和NML均由一系列C++类来实现,NML类是CMS类的派生类。NML类提供的更新函数可以对数据格式进行转换,从而使得模块间可以跨平台进行通信。 本文提出的递阶分布式控制系统中,每个模块完成一个给定的任务,我们开发了一个通用的NML模块类NML_MODULE来实现模块的基本操作,模块在给定的周期内,执行预先定义好的动作来完成给定的任务。 系统的设计中还提供了一个重要的代码自动生成工具,利用它可以自动生成整个应用程序的框架,用户只需添加少量实现具体控制算法的代码即可完成对整个控制系统的设计,这大大减轻了程序员的负担。此外,还提供了图形化的设计平台,用户可以借助形象化的图形灵活地构建控制系统的结构,借助诊断工具平台用户可以对控制系统进行控制,向运行中的模块发送控制命令或设定参数值,用户还可以通过诊断工具对系统进行仿真和测试,验证其是否能达到期望的控制目标。
其他文献
论文的主要工作如下:1)对指纹预处理算法进行了研究.采用直方图均衡法来增强指纹图像;然后使用局域自适应阈值法对指纹图像进行二值化处理;然后对二值图像进行后处理,在此基
虚拟组织是目前广泛出现的电子系统的核心技术,例如电子商务、电子政务、电子制造系统等等.在这种需要反复组织的动态系统中,难以用符号逻辑来模式化地描述信息,因此本文采用
实际工程系统不可避免受到各种随机因素的干扰,当对系统性能指标有较高要求时,需要考虑建立随机系统模型进行系统分析和综合。通常建立的随机系统模型具有很强的非线性特征,传统
本论文采用模糊控制与直接转矩控制相结合的方法对FANUC机器人关节交流异步驱动电动机进行控制研究。采用模糊控制器取代了传统的转矩、磁链两点式Bang-Bang控制,全面综合考虑
随着《电力法》及其配套法规的颁布,国家加快了对电力工业的改革步伐。供电企业也进入了体制改革的关键阶段,电力商品开始由卖方市场向买方市场转变。如何实行有效的电力经济分
高精度逆变电源是一种重要的特种电源,在科学研究、医疗和工业生产中有着广泛的应用,其中一个典型应用就是作为电动振动实验台的驱动电源。针对该电源的特殊技术指标要求,本文提
非线性控制理论在很长的一段时间以来一直处于系统分析阶段,即“描述性”(descriptive)阶段。直至上世纪七、八十年代,原先仅仅应用于对非线性系统进行分析的概念逐渐被应用到
群体智能是近年来发展的新学科,主要关注自然界的自组织行为.蚁群系统是群体智能的典型例子,它具有当代制造系统所追求的很多特性,并在作业车间和流水车间中得到了很好的应用
目标识别是各种机器视觉系统所要解决的关键技术.本文对目标识别进行了系统地综述,分析了军事目标识别各个发展阶段的特点.在数学形态学、分形几何、图像分割、图像特征分析
直升机旋翼是为直升机飞行产生升力和操纵力的直升机核心部件。对直升机的机动性、操纵性、速度、振动水平、寿命、安全性及维护性等有着巨大的影响。旋翼共锥度是旋翼动平衡